Kinds of Welding Qualifications
Despite the fact that the American Welding Society’s basic CW (Certified Welder) certification opens the door for almost all jobs, many industries mandate a certain certificate. Several of the most-common of them are listed below.
-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
- API Certification for welders who deal with pipelines in the oil and gas field
- CW Credentials to be a Certified Welder
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ders who deal with boiler and pressurized vessels

The below table illustrates pay and labor estimates for welding professionals in Wyoming through 2022.
| Wyoming |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 2,440 | 2,730 | 12% | 90 |
| Wyoming |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$30,700 | $46,100 | $73,300 |
Source: O*Net Online
Things You Should Know in Welding Training
You’ve made the decision that you really want to become a welding specialist, so at this moment you should determine which of the welding schools is the ideal one. Once you start your search, you’ll find dozens of programs, but what should you really think about when picking welding specialist classes? We simply can’t emphasize too much the significance of the school you select being accredited and authorized by the AWS. Although not as critical as the accreditation status, you might want to consider most of the following factors as well:
- Be certain the program trains on equipment that suits field specifications
- Determine if the institution gives financial assistance
- You should make sure the school’s curriculum provides training in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
- Attempt to find institutions that cover AWS SENSE standards
